the joint in the human body, which bears the main load during movement, it provides greater mobility. at the same time, maintaining stability under the pressure of the entire body mass, such pressure is a serious test. for articular cartilage over the years. this leads to microdamage and degenerative-dystrophic changes in the joint and thus develops coxarthrosis. the mechanism of development of coxarthrosis is associated with a deterioration in the quality of the natural lubrication of the synovial fluid under the influence of harmful factors. she becomes more viscous. as a result, cartilage dries up and even bones wear out. causes and factors contributing to the occurrence of coxarthrosis can be injuries and prolonged excessive stress on the hip joints fractures dislocations of fragmentation of the joint, as well as chronic permanent microtraumas of dancers and athletes congenital anomalies in the development of dysplasia up to 90% of cases of onropathy,
1:35 pm
the transferred inflammatory process metabolic disorders aseptic osteonecrosis to stop the destruction his joint needs to be nourished. and for this it is necessary to move in order to increase blood circulation and lymphatics. and also start the oxidative processes in the muscles. then the production of synovial fluid is normalized and the degenerative process will slow down the treatment of the hip joints. it includes the occupation of therapeutic culture physiotherapy dosed walking unloading of the hip joints, which includes weight loss, the creation of additional support and the transfer of part of the body weight. on a cane or crutches for advanced arthrosis we offer a set of exercises for coxarthrosis the advantage of this complex is the provision of a non-muscle load, which is especially important in this pathology, adaptive physical education is what diseased joints need, having studied the medical history of the pictures to the hotel. an mri kinesiotherapist conducts an

veal, or what is the difference between them, and the difference is fundamental here, and beef. this is the meat of adult gobies on the territory of our country, and this also includes the meat of cows. well, it's usually tougher more sinewy, for example. in some countries abroad, the meat of cows, in principle, is practically not eaten, and veal is the meat of young gobies from 3 to 8 months. this meat is more tender, more juicy and in color. it is very different from beef. it is usually lighter. well, if we compared all the same, two types, veal and beef, let's tell our viewers. which one has more calories. ah, well, veal itself. this meat is more dietary, you can even say lean, and there is much less fat, but not
1:39 pm
only this difference, uh, there is more potassium in veal. e more magnesium more phosphorus, but at the same time there is an advantage and beef in beef has more iron more universe, and beef has more vitamin. 12 because vitamin b12 accumulates in the body of an animal during life and, accordingly, in meat, and there is practically no calf, that is, it is very small, namely vitamin b12 plays an important role in the work of the human nervous system, and also in addition to creation, sometimes a constant, it is not clear where it came from anemia in humans is associated precisely with vitamin b12 deficiency, and it is important to remember this for all people who take metformin on an ongoing basis, that is, people with diabetes.
1:40 pm
but if we talk about calories, then the calorie content of meat just depends on the presence of fat, in my opinion, there are 98 kilocalories per 100 g of veal, and about 200 per 100 g of beef. that is why dietitians are doctors. that is, you recommend to people reducing. still, more often to use veal than beef, and nikolai here it is still very important to remember that there will be a different part of the animal's body. the fat content, and indeed the calorie content, you guessed it, moreover, even lean types of beef can contain about 250 kilocalories. it would seem that lean should be low-calorie, but there really quite a lot of fat. moreover, this fat is made up of saturated fatty acids, precisely those that contribute to
1:41 pm
the formation of atherosclerotic plaques, and an increase in the level of cholesterol in our blood. and, which means that the risk of strokes, heart attacks, thrombosis and so on increases. that is why it is important. what about beef? it's a good complete protein, but you don't need to consume it. this meat daily one or two times a week will be enough to get all the benefits and not get the harm that we get. with saturated fats moreover, it is very important to understand that people who have problems with uric acid, that is, high levels of uric acid, and the deposition of uric acid salts in the joints, which leads to gout a-a, the deposition of uric acid stones in the kidneys it is recommended to reduce the consumption of red meats to 1-2 times a month, and ideally completely avoid the consumption of these e,
1:42 pm
victoria varieties, but another main plus of beef or veal is that there is heme iron, and this component is very important for our body, without it. we can't even live, but nikolai that's why people who consume red meat regularly, as a rule, have a lower risk of developing iron deficiency anemia, because it is this very gem iron that is practically absorbed in the intestines. eh, regardless of external circumstances. the status is in the word a and is absorbed in a fairly high percentage, unlike, for example, iron from vegetables and fruits, in which, uh, iron itself may be much more, but no more than 1% is absorbed quiz in order to preserve the benefits of meat, it needs to be cooked correctly, and only men can do it well, and so cyril please tell us how to properly cook meat in honesty beef or veal. the most important subtlety
